When you create a tunnel from the thing details page of the AWS IoT console, you can also specify whether to create a new tunnel or open an existing tunnel for that thing, as illustrated in this tutorial. The tutorials in this section focus on creating a tunnel using the AWS Management Console and the AWS IoT API reference. In the AWS IoT console, you can create a tunnel from the tunnels hub page or from the details page of a thing that you created.
The tutorials show you how you can open a tunnel and then use that tunnel to start an SSH session to a remote device. Prerequisites for the tutorials the prerequisites for running the tutorial can vary depending on whether you use the manual or quick setup methods for opening a tunnel and accessing the remote device.

Compared to other protocols like telnet, ssh offers superior security features. While telnet transmits data in plain text, ssh encrypts all communication, making it a safer choice for iot devices.
